... E standard. The internal DC/DC converter can switch between multiple voltages, realizing the allowing it to operate with a single +3 power supply. It also provides standby function. This IC incorporates 2 driver circuits and 2 receiver circuits. An RS-232 interface circuit can be easily configured by connecting 5 capacitors externally.
